Lakeland man who played city's Santa among 19 arrested in PCSO sting

A Lakeland man who has played Santa Claus for roughly a decade in the city’s Christmas parades, waving and taking photos with thousands of children, is one of 19 people arrested in a recent child-sex sting conducted by the Polk County Sheriff’s Office.

Thomas Allen Hicks, 68, was arrested on April 21 and faces felony charges, including human trafficking for forced sex trade of a child younger than 18, traveling to meet with and using a computer to solicit a minor, and unlawful use of a two-way communication device. The top charge carries a maximum penalty of up to 30 years in prison.

“This is a guy who is well known in Polk County, Central Florida and Lakeland as a for-hire Santa Claus,” Polk Sheriff Grady Judd said at a April 29 news conference. “It’s scary, as this guy was well respected in the community.”

Hicks responded to an online ad and texted back-and-forth with an undercover officer posing as the father of a 13-year-old girl who was being offered for sexual activity, according to an affidavit filed with Polk County Clerk of Court. The Sheriff’s Office said Hicks offered $200 for an hour with the girl. The text messages included a photo exchange, which was used to help identify Hicks.

Hicks spoke with Chris Hansen, former host of the TV series “How to Catch a Predator” immediately following his arrest, Judd said. Hansen will be appearing to talk to Fox News’ Jessie Watters Primetime at 8 p.m. April 29.

The Sheriff’s Office said Hicks works in marketing for Tri-County Human Services, a Lakeland-based nonprofit that provided services for individuals facing mental health issues, alcohol and drug addiction. He also served as a pastor, previously at First Alliance Church in Lakeland, according to a February 2022 report from Orlando Voyager.

Polk around and find out

Judd said there were 18 other people arrested during a weeklong sting operation titled “Polk around & Find Out” that occurred from April 20 to 26.

Of the 19 arrested, 16 traveled up to three hours with the intention of meeting up with a child to engage in illegal sexual activity, Judd said.
